Quick Finish + Rebound

2-shot sequence: first-time finish then react for a rebound. Great for tempo + composure.

Theme: FinishingAge: U12Level: Grassroots

1v1 Gate Attack

Attack a gate with speed. Defender scores by winning and countering through the opposite gate.

Theme: 1v1Age: U9Level: Grassroots

High Press Trigger Game

Press on cue (bad touch/back pass). Win it and attack within 6 seconds for double points.

Theme: PressingAge: U16Level: Academy

Build-Up Under Pressure

Play out from the back with targets. Constraints encourage scanning + playing forward.

Theme: Build-upAge: U14Level: Academy

4v4 Transition Waves

Continuous waves: if you lose it, you immediately counter-press. Score within 8 seconds.

Theme: TransitionAge: AdultLevel: Semi-Pro

Keep-Ball + End Zone

Keep possession, then break lines into the end zone. Add neutrals to create overloads.

Theme: PossessionAge: U12Level: Grassroots
